Engineered Base Layers & Site Preparation
We use laser grading and compacted layers to build a stable, long-lasting foundation. Our arena base typically includes:
Deep excavation to remove unsuitable soils
Geotextile fabric for layer separation
Crushed rock or metal dust compacted in stages
Precision laser-graded camber or fall for controlled drainage

Drainage That Keeps You Riding
A well-built arena shouldn’t become a swamp every time it rains. That’s why we integrate smart drainage into every build:
Slight camber or crossfall for passive water runoff
Subsurface drains or perimeter French drains if needed
Base materials that promote filtration and rapid drying

Choosing the Right Site
The land tells us a lot. When selecting where your arena should go, we assess:
Natural Drainage & Soil Type: Heavy clays or poorly draining areas create issues long after construction.
Slope & Orientation: A slight fall helps drainage. North–south orientation minimises sun glare.
Access & Surroundings: Clear access from stables or float parking makes daily use more efficient. Shelter from prevailing winds improves conditions year-round.

Getting Dimensions & Layout Right
We don’t do one-size-fits-all – we do:
Standard Discipline Sizes: From 60x20m dressage to larger 70x40m multipurpose spaces – all shapes and sizes.
Clear Zones: We allow for safe clearance, spectator areas, float access and can build round yards or warm-up rings.

Long-Term Maintenance
Even the best arena needs upkeep.
Regular Grooming: Keeps footing level and prevents compaction
Moisture Management: Watering or sprinklers if needed, especially in WA’s dry heat
